If as a developer you want to be seen as someone advancing and taking ownership and responsibility, testing must be part of the process. Sending an untested product or a product that you as a software engineer do not monitor, essentially means you can never be sure you created an actual correct product. That is no engineering. If the org guidelines prevent it, some cultural piece prevents it. Adding QA outside, which tests software regularly using different approaches, finding intersections etc. is a different topic. Both are necessary. |
